After flying high against Magnolia on Friday, Rancho Alamitos came back down to earth. The Vaqueros fell just short of the Bolsa Grande Matadors by a score of 12-11 on Wednesday. The Vaqueros' loss signaled the end of their six-game winning streak.
Fernanda Cervantes put in work no matter where she played. She struck out six batters over six innings while giving up just one earned (and five unearned) runs off four hits. That's the fewest earned runs she has allowed since back in February. She was also solid in the batter's box, going 2-for-4 with three runs.
Cervantes wasn't the only one making solid contact as four players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Alejandra Corona, who went a perfect 4-for-4 with three runs and one RBI.
Rancho Alamitos' record now sits at 7-6. As for Bolsa Grande, they have been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 6-11 record this season.
Rancho Alamitos will take on Century at 3:00 p.m. on Friday. The Vaqueros will need to watch out since the Centurions have now posted at least ten runs in their last six games. As for Bolsa Grande, they will face off against Magnolia at 3:15 p.m. on Friday. The Matadors are facing the Sentinels at the right time seeing as the Sentinels are stuck on an eight-game losing streak.
